Dianne McKenzie Morgan, age 57, of Oak Ridge, TN, went home to be with Jesus on October 26, 2024.

Dianne was born in Carrollton, GA to Rev. Jesse Enver McKenzie and Lorene Lands McKenzie on August 5, 1967. She graduated from Carrollton High School in 1985, played the flute in the marching band, and worked at Dunkin Donuts.

She married Alan Morgan on June 4, 1988. Together, they lived in Georgia, Florida, and North Carolina before settling in East Tennessee.

Dianne contributed to the music and children’s ministries at Oak View Baptist Church in High Point, NC for over 10 years. She and her best friend, Kim Clewis, directed the children’s choir together and enjoyed building extravagant sets for their productions. Dianne sang in the church choir and was involved in Awana, Vacation Bible School, church drama productions, Sunday School, and anywhere else she was needed to serve.

She represented pharmaceutical companies throughout her career selling products for diabetes care and sleep disorders. Her greatest joy and motivation was to bring a better quality of life to patients. As a result, she earned many performance awards and accolades. She always said the best part of her job was a doctor calling to say that her product had drastically improved someone’s life. Despite the toll that the disease and treatments had taken on her body, she continued to visit offices up to the final weeks of her life.

While working full time, Dianne graduated cum laude with a Bachelor’s of Science in both Business Administration and Bible & Theology from Johnson University.

Dianne was a gifted writer, loved to have fun, play games, and cook, making her home a place of peace and communion. She believed in and embodied the Hebrew “Shalom,” bringing a wholeness to the world around her. She leaves a legacy of loving like Jesus does.

Dianne is preceded in death by parents Rev J. E. and Lorene McKenzie, brother Ray McKenzie, mother-in-love Gloria Ivy, and great niece Krista Elizabeth Myers.

Dianne is survived by husband Alan Morgan, son and daughter-in-love Daniel and Brittany Morgan, daughter Lori Morgan, brother Dennis McKenzie (Kathleen McKenzie), sisters Barbara Hemrick (Colon Hemrick) and Deborah Argo (Eddie Argo) and many loved nieces & nephews, great nieces & nephews, cousins, best friends, and honorary sons and daughters.
